1. 首页
  2. 云计算
  3. kubernetes
  4. STM32AES256加密串口IAP升级Bootloader套件

STM32AES256加密串口IAP升级Bootloader套件

上传者: 2025-06-15 15:56:45上传 ZIP文件 326.14KB 热度 1次

STM32 的 AES256 加密串口 IAP 升级套件,蛮适合搞 Bootloader 开发的朋友。程序结构清晰,串口协议也比较规范,关键是加密部分做得还不错,用的AES256对称加密,传输过程中更安全。你只要改一下设备 ID 和密钥,基本就能无缝接到自己的项目里。

主控用的STM32芯片,支持常见的串口 IAP 升级流程,接上串口,上位机一跑就能刷固件,响应也挺快的。配套的上位机软件也不是那种半成品,UI 简单,但功能齐——选择串口、加载固件、一键升级,全都有。

代码这块写得挺干净,函数命名也清晰,新手也能看得明白。你要是之前搞过 STM32 的 Bootloader,这套代码可以直接拿来改。比如iap_update()check_firmware()这些函数,用起来就像乐高积木,插上就能用。

要注意一点,上位机和下位机之间的协议格式别乱动,尤其是包头校验这块。否则你会遇到“发了数据没响应”的那种小坑。哦对,固件加密之前要确认密钥一致,不然解密失败你都不知道哪错了。

如果你在找一套能直接上手的STM32 Bootloader方案,又想顺带把安全性拉满,那这套资源挺值一试。下面这几个链接可以按需挑着下:

如果你是做工业设备的、或者自己项目刚好需要固件远程升级,这类安全性强、逻辑完整的套件会帮你省不少事。

下载地址
用户评论